ToolSharp Documentation

ToolSharp is a part of the ToolX library, focusing specifically on image processing and manipulation. It leverages the sharp library, known for its efficiency and robust capabilities in handling image transformations. ToolSharp provides a user-friendly interface to access the advanced features of sharp, making it a go-to solution for image-related tasks in the ToolX environment.

Options

ToolSharp comes with a comprehensive set of options that allow users to control different aspects of image processing:

General Options

  • settings: Configure the sharp class options.
  • ext: Set the output file extension.
  • scale: Configure the image scale.
  • exts: Specify allowed file extensions.
  • api: Access sharp library features.

Image Processing Options

  • resize: Adjust image dimensions.
  • rotate: Rotate the image.
  • flip: Flip the image vertically.
  • flop: Flip the image horizontally.
  • sharpen: Sharpen the image.
  • threshold: Apply image binarization.
  • composite: Overlay images.
  • toFormat: Set output format.
  • jpeg: JPEG-specific options.
  • png: PNG-specific options.
  • webp: WebP-specific options.
  • avif: AVIF-specific options.
  • heif: HEIF-specific options.
  • tiff: TIFF-specific options.
  • gif: GIF-specific options.
  • jp2: JPEG 2000 options.
  • jxl: JPEG XL options.
  • raw: RAW format options.
  • tile: Image tiling options.
  • removeAlpha: Remove alpha channel.
  • ensureAlpha: Ensure alpha channel.
  • extractChannel: Extract a color channel.
  • joinChannel: Join channels to the image.
  • bandbool: Apply a boolean operation.
  • tint: Tint the image.
  • greyscale/grayscale: Convert to greyscale.
  • pipelineColourspace/pipelineColorspace: Set pipeline colorspace.
  • toColourspace/toColorspace: Set output colorspace.
  • affine: Perform affine transformation.
  • median: Apply a median filter.
  • blur: Blur the image.
  • flatten: Merge alpha channel.
  • gamma: Apply gamma correction.
  • negate: Create a negative image.
  • normalise/normalize: Enhance contrast.
  • clahe: Adaptive histogram equalization.
  • convolve: Convolve with a kernel.
  • recomb: Recombine using a matrix.

Usage Examples

Basic Usage

javascript
import ToolSharp from '@toolx/core';

// Example usage
const toolSharp = new ToolSharp({
    ext: 'jpg',
    scale: 1.5,
    api: {
        resize: { width: 300, height: 200 },
        rotate: 90,
        sharpen: true,
        // Other sharp options
    }
});

// Run the tool
toolSharp.run(inputFilePath, outputFilePath).then(() => {
    console.log('Image processing complete');
});

Advanced Usage in a Pipeline

javascript
import { Pipeline } from '@toolx/core';
import ToolSharp from '@toolx/sharp';
import ToolOther from '@toolx/other'; // Another ToolX tool

// Setting up the pipeline
const pipeline = new Pipeline();
pipeline.compose(
    new ToolOther(/* ToolOther options */),
    new ToolSharp({
        ext: 'png',
        scale: 2,
        api: {
            resize: { width: 600 },
            flip: true,
            toFormat: 'png',
            // Other sharp options
        }
    })
);

// Run the pipeline
pipeline.run(inputPath, outputPath).then(() => {
    console.log('Image processing pipeline complete');
});
